Output dba82c6f4fe958e51fe3eed3d57852b15ad89d83bb5cad7603a84bdd825e27cc:0

value
5080589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2bf808d0ec6b4865c4d644213ecf15887ef03ec OP_EQUAL
address
3LuMEdYnYjvRMrBWxpZ2ewiNvYwtWdxu73
transaction
dba82c6f4fe958e51fe3eed3d57852b15ad89d83bb5cad7603a84bdd825e27cc
spent
true